As an advanced information-based learning environment, smart classrooms have exerted a profound influence on learning. This study aims at investigating students' learning experience and academic achievements in smart classrooms, and further exploring the correlation between them as well. It applies the questionnaire, the semi-structured interview and tests, and the results show that: Firstly, overall students have a good learning experience in smart classrooms. To be specific, the experience of technology is best, and the experience of space is fairly high, whereas the experience of pedagogy is relatively low. Secondly, most students can obtain high academic achievements through learning in smart classrooms. Thirdly, although there is no statistically significant correlation between learning experience and academic achievements in smart classrooms, students can actually perceive the interactive effect between them. These findings are expected to provide some reference or implications for the future construction, application and research of smart classrooms.
